ICYMI
Industry news that mattered this week
IT’S POPULAR 🎶 - The Wicked Soundtrack had the highest debut for a big-screen adaptation of a stage musical EVER, and the Broadway Cast Album hit the Billboard 200 Top 40 for the first time. HYBE-owned label Ador took legal action against K-pop group NewJeans over their contract. HYBE’s Bang Si-hyuk is under investigation from South Korea’s financial regulator over “secret” contracts with certain shareholders. Ultra Music Publishing sued Sony Music over copyright infringement.
Spotify Wrapped arrived and women truly dominated music in 2024. Bad Bunny was the top-streamed Latin Artist for the 5th year in a row. Amazon Music launched their new yearly recap 2024 Delivered and Apple Music’s Relay 2024 was also released this week.
Experts weighed in on Drake’s legal action vs. UMG.
Attorneys are working to get their producer clients paid for their work on Ye’s Vultures 1. A new Led Zeppelin doc is set to release in 2025. U.S. Customs and Border Protection seized over $18M in counterfeit Gibson guitars arriving from Asia. Voting fraud was uncovered in the 2024 Music Victoria Awards, affecting 5 categories. small print
Updates on companies, acquisitions, takeovers and more
Live Nation acquired a majority stake in talent management firm, Timeline.
Goldstate Music purchased catalogs from CatchPoint Rights Partners and AMR songs for $200M
Sony acquired Greek indie label Cobalt Music
.Music unveiled new smartbadge and smartpage digital identity technology
14M people attended the in-game concert, Fortnite ‘Remix: The Finale’
BMG parent company partnered with AI startup ElevenLabs
Artist marketing platform un:hurd acquires Thailand-based IndieKnow
Reservoir acquired the rights to GRAMMY-winner and Lion King composer Lebo M.’s catalog

Fresh Ink
Interesting artist signings
HARDY, alongside Dallas Smith, Jake Worthington & McCoy Moore, joined Troy “Tracker” Johnson’s new co TRACK mgmt.
Australian electronic artist CYRIL signed with Warner Chappell for publishing.
After almost 20 years with RCA Nashville, Chris Young signed with Black River Entertainment for records.
Icelandic indie folk/rock band Of Monsters and Men joined the Red Light Management roster.
Returning with new music in 2025, punk cabaret duo The Dresden Dolls signed with ATC Live for touring in Europe.
Recent Latin GRAMMY Best New Artist winner Ela Taubert signed with Kobalt for publishing.

The Live World
Tour, festival and other live news
🎸 Biggest tours announced this week: Kendrick Lamar & SZA, AC/DC, Pearl Jam, Pierce The Veil, Flatland Cavalry, Kraftwerk
If you’ve been wanting to hear ‘Not Like Us’ live - here’s your chance. Kendrick Lamar & SZA announced a 19-date North American tour next year.
After a 30-show run last year at the Sphere, Dead & Co are returning for a 18-show residency in 2025 along with updated visuals to celebrate their 10th anniversary.
Reading & Leeds Festival has announced the first set of artists performing at next year’s festival including headliners Hozier, Travis Scott & Chappell Roan.
No, the Arctic Monkeys are not embarking on a 2025 world tour. It was recently revealed that scammers have been posing as the band’s agent to solicit bookings.
Kate Nash has joined OnlyFans to raise money for her tour and protest as part of her Butts for Tour Buses Campaign.
As a part of the Golden Gate Park Concert Summer Series, Zach Bryan has been announced as a headliner with Kings of Leon supporting.
Festival Boots In The Park is making its way to Las Vegas next year with performances by headliners Old Dominion, Jordan Davis & more.

On The Move
New hires, exec moves and other people news
Sony Music UK appoints former UMG Catalog Exec Azi Eftekhari as COO. Dan Rosen named Prez of Records & Publishing AUS at WMG. Katie Kerkhover will lead A&R Frontline Recordings across NA for BMG. Cara Donatto is named EVP of Media Strategy for AMG. ADA Worldwide expands making Rasti Sryantoro Head of ADA Indonesia and Arisa Maruekatat Head of ADA Thailand. Jeff Roberto joins Splice as SVP of Marketing. Bill Walshe is Sphere’s new EVP, Global Head of Venue Ops and Development.
Big Loud Rock names Jenn Essiembre new SVP of A&R. Live Performance Australia appoints Eric Lassen as CEO. Various Artists Management (VAM) has promoted Rebecca Dixon to Global Head of Marketing and GM, UK. Natasha Baldwin promoted to Prez, Global Classics, Jazz & Screen at UMG. VenuWorks names Scott Smith as National Director of Ops. Tommy Moore will exit ACM after 13 years. Goldenvoice names Lea Swanson as VP of Talent while SVP Susan Rosenbluth announces retirement after a career that spans six decades.
